Change the title when in call/media state

* Change the title when in call/media state.
  Example: call state show "Available call devices"
           media state show "Available media devices"
* Use isAudioModeOngoingCall() utility function for checking if it is in call status
* Add register test to verify when in onStart() and onStop()
  the BluetoothCallback can be register and unregister.
* Add title string test to verify when in call or media state,
  the title can be changed to corresponding string

Bug: 78150641
Test: make -j40 RunSettingsRoboTests
